Description
Nos 52 and 54 on Fore Street are a building from the 18th century that has been altered or may date to the early 19th century. This three-storey structure features three flush frame sash windows, although most of the glazing bars are missing. The exterior is plastered and painted, with flank pilasters, a band on the first floor, and a wooden eaves cornice. The ground floor has been converted into modern shops, and there is a central passage leading to Khartoum Place. This building is part of a group that includes Nos 42 to 84 (even), No 92, and The Shambles.
